Stay Curious—Stay Human
AI@SCI is the Science Center of Iowa’s initiative to understand and responsibly teach the continuously evolving branch of computer science known as artificial intelligence (AI). We offer playful, hands-on experiences that make AI approachable regardless of a learner’s age, background, or prior knowledge. We have designed methods to communicate AI concepts intuitively to break down the misconception that the field is “only for experts.”
We promote AI education by equipping teachers, students, parents, and museum visitors with information and resources they can use to understand the power, risks, and basic mechanics of the AI technology field.
Why SCI? Why Now?
AI is Here
AI is no longer abstract—it recommends videos, powers voice assistants, supports healthcare diagnostics, and even influences hiring and financial decisions. Learners of all ages benefit from understanding the invisible systems that are shaping their daily choices and opportunities.
We Need Critical Thinkers
As an informal educational institution, SCI is uniquely positioned to help learners ask “How does this work?” and “What does this mean for me?” By demystifying AI, we foster skepticism, curiosity, and ethical questioning—skills essential for navigating a world where technologies evolve faster than policy and social norms.
Responsible Usage Matters
AI is powerful, but also fraught with challenges: bias, misinformation, environmental costs, job displacement, and privacy concerns. SCI is leading the way in responsible teaching by presenting both the potential and the pitfalls, helping our visitors critically evaluate hype versus reality.
Lifelong Learning & Workforce Preparation
SCI engages and inspires Iowans along their journey of lifelong science learning. By providing exposure to AI concepts and tools, we prepare our community for a workforce where AI literacy will be as fundamental as digital literacy is today. This builds resilience and adaptability in the face of rapid change.
By embracing the power of AI, we demonstrate that this technology isn’t limited to tech companies or universities—it’s for everyone, and it can be explored in safe, supportive, and human-centered environments!

Adult/Corporate Workshops - As part of the AI@SCI initiative, our adult and corporate workshops in the Innovation Lab immerse participants in hands-on, human-centered experiences that demystify artificial intelligence and make emerging technologies accessible for every profession. These 2–4-hour sessions blend collaborative problem-solving with practical tools, inviting teams to explore how AI can streamline workflows, spark innovation, strengthen decision-making, and enhance communication. Participants experiment with real AI applications, from generative design and rapid prototyping to data-driven insights and creative ideation, while also building confidence in ethical use, responsible leadership, and future-ready skills. Each workshop is designed to energize teams, deepen understanding, and empower participants to navigate a rapidly changing technological landscape with curiosity, creativity, and intention.
Explore the Future of Learning with Space + AI - Hands-on workshops at the SCI Innovation Lab blend STEM, maker technologies, and inquiry-based learning with practical AI applications. Designed for educators, each session empowers participants to bring innovation to the classroom—with ready-to-use materials and space-themed content supported by NASA's Iowa Space Grant Consortium.
